VB编程:for循环输出杨辉三角

简介: VB编程:for循环输出杨辉三角

运行效果:

cee7ece8a51bb8cdf94e6921091fc10d.png


程序代码:

Private Sub Command1_Click()

   Dim a()

   n = 10           'Val(Text1.Text)

   Me.Cls

   ReDim a(n + 1, n + 1)

   For i = 1 To n

       For j = 0 To i

           a(1, i) = 1

           a(i, i) = 1

           a(i + 1, j + 1) = a(i, j) + a(i, j + 1)

           Print a(i, j);

       Next j

       Print

   Next i

End Sub


学习总结:

算法的五大特性:

1、有穷性

2、确定性

3、可行性

4、输入

5、输出


相关文章
|
10月前
|
C语言
C语言:写一个代码,使用 试除法 打印100~200之间的素数(质数)-1
思路一:使用试除法 总体思路: (一). 使用外循环:生成 100~200 之间的数。 (二). 设置内循环:生成 2 ~ i-1 的数。
|
10月前
|
C语言
C语言:写一个代码,使用 试除法 打印100~200之间的素数(质数)-2
思路二: 总体思路: 因为偶数除了 2 都不是素数,且题目范围中没有 2 , 所以可以只生成 100~200 之间的奇数,可以排除一半的数字, 效率提升一倍。
|
10月前
编程输出九九乘法表
编程输出九九乘法表
|
10月前
|
算法 C语言
[C语言][典例详解]打印杨辉三角(找规律简单实现)
[C语言][典例详解]打印杨辉三角(找规律简单实现)
87 0
|
12月前
|
Java
java实现九九乘法表的输出
java实现九九乘法表的输出
56 0
|
C语言
C语言 输出三角形数列 for循环
C语言 输出三角形数列 for循环
|
C语言
C语言 打印九九乘法表 for循环
C语言 打印九九乘法表 for循环
73 0
|
Python
考点:函数参数传参、求和、奇数、偶数、输入输出、range步长灵活使用【Python习题04】
考点:函数参数传参、求和、奇数、偶数、输入输出、range步长灵活使用【Python习题04】
140 0